Islam is a religion that has a rich and diverse history, with many changes and continuities throughout its development.

One major continuity in Islam is the belief in one God, or Allah, and the importance of following the teachings of the prophet Muhammad. From the time of its founding in the 7th century, Islam has emphasized monotheism and the belief in one all-powerful, all-knowing deity. This belief is central to the faith and has remained unchanged throughout its history.

Another continuity in Islam is the importance of the Qur'an, which is the holy book of Islam and is believed to be the word of God as revealed to Muhammad. The Qur'an contains the teachings and guidelines for Muslims to follow in order to live a righteous and fulfilling life. The Qur'an has remained unchanged since its revelation and is considered to be the ultimate authority in Islam.

However, there have also been many changes in Islam throughout its history. One significant change was the development of different sects within the religion, such as the Sunni and Shia branches. These sects developed as a result of political and theological differences, and they have different beliefs and practices.

Another change in Islam has been the relationship between religion and politics. In the early history of Islam, the religion and the state were closely intertwined, with the caliph (political leader) also serving as the religious leader. However, over time, the separation of religion and politics has become more common in many Muslim-majority countries, with governments being secular and religion being a personal matter.

In terms of cultural practices, Islam has also undergone changes. For example, the role of women in Islam has varied throughout history and continues to be a subject of debate within the Muslim world. In some Muslim-majority countries, women have had greater rights and freedoms, while in others, they have had more restrictive roles.

Overall, Islam has experienced both changes and continuities throughout its history. While core beliefs and practices such as monotheism and the importance of the Qur'an have remained unchanged, the religion has also adapted to different cultural and political contexts, resulting in the development of different sects and the evolution of cultural practices.
